Our family business was founded on doing things differently. We believe that running a business is about far more than making money. It's about maintaining a culture that cares about people. It's about giving back to a community that has given us so much. It's about doing what we think is right, even if it's not reflected in the bottom line.

 

Like many families in our town, our employee family has had its share of grief and our clients have weathered all kinds of storms under our unpredictable Texas skies. And yet, all of these experiences have brought us together and made us a stronger community.

 

To honor some of those we've lost, we host an annual golf tournament to fund scholarships for students in need. Over the past 22 years, we have distributed 235 scholarships totaling more than $625,000. My father and I also host an endowed scholarship for students at the Baylor School of Business, and our employees are very active in charitable organizations such as the MS 150 and Relay for Life. In 2006, we were honored to receive “The Workplace Hero” award from the American Red Cross. Truly one of our proudest moments.

 

So, even as we look forward to the future, we'll never forget that our people have made us who we are today. We'll keep growing the independent spirit our business was founded on without compromising the hometown values that make our company special. But most of all, we look forward to making you a part of our family, too.
